Press Release - Personnel Announcement

November 14, 2008

President George W. Bush today announced his intention to nominate one individual to serve in his Administration.

The President intends to nominate Neil M. Barofsky, of New York, to be Special Inspector General for the Troubled Asset Relief Program at the Department of the Treasury. He currently serves as an Assistant United States Attorney for the Southern District of New York and Chief of the Mortgage Fraud Group. Prior to this, he served as a lead prosecutor in the Southern District's Securities Fraud Unit. Previously, he served in the Southern District's International Narcotics Trafficking Unit. Mr. Barofsky earned two bachelor's degrees from the University of Pennsylvania and his JD from the New York University School of Law.
